Originally Posted by AU N EGL
Steve

Oil pools in the heads under hard hard high G braking or high G left hand sweepers and does not return the pan. Bearings go dry and BANG.

High G meaning over 1.2 Gs

Solution is a real Dry sump, or change the heads out to 243 heads or an other aftermarket head.
A few guys tried Smith Brothers Push rods to limit the oil into the heads but that did not work

This is on a road course. Normal hot rodding about drag racing should not be a problem.
This is interesting. You're saying enough oil can get trapped under the rocker arm covers to starve the engine? So what then are we talking, a quart in each head or something?

I was just about to come to the defense of the LS3 heads and their ability to make all kinds of power with the stock 315 or so odd CFM.

So do you know what it is about the LS3 head design that differs from others allowing the trapped oil?
